Facebook group lead generation: the system

A Facebook group becomes more valuable when member intent can flow into an owned follow-up channel.

1. Attract the right members

Make the group promise specific enough that new members share a recognizable problem or goal.

2. Ask better membership questions

Use questions to understand intent and, when appropriate, invite an email opt-in tied to a relevant resource.

3. Capture and organize

Move voluntarily provided data into a structured system such as a spreadsheet or connected email platform.

4. Follow up

Use a welcome message and email sequence that delivers what was promised before asking for a sale.
